We are pleased to announce the upcoming EUCanScreen Consortium Meeting & Collaborative Sessions, which will be held from 12 to 14 May 2025, in the beautiful city of Turin, Italy. This event promises to be a great chance for the consortium to collaborate, share knowledge, and coordinate strategic objectives.
The event will be structured over three days, focusing on strategic discussions, governance, and collaborative sessions to enhance synergy across WP and Tasks.
Agenda overview
🔹 12 May – starting at 9:00 – Work Package (WP) individual meetings & strategic discussions on synergies with Joint Actions
🔹 13 May – General meeting & governance body sessions
🔹 14 May – Parallel sessions fostering WP & Task collaboration, ending at 15:30.

The general objective of EUCanScreen is to assure sustainable implementation of high-quality screening for breast, cervical and colorectal cancers, as well as implementation of the recently recommended screening programs – for lung, prostate and gastric cancers. EUCanScreen will facilitate the reduction of cancer burden and achieving equity across the EU.
